Ethiopian Farmers Battle Devastating Locust Invasion


Farmers in Ethiopia’s Tigray region battled a devastating desert locust invasion on October 5. Media reported the insects had damaged about 200,000 hectares (500,000 acres) of land since January, as the country continued to struggle with food insecurity amid the coronavirus pandemic. Tigray Development Association (TDA) told Storyful the regional state was facing the worst desert locust swarm outbreak in decades. Given the COVID-19 disaster, the people are now subjected to a ‘double pandemic’” said the Executive Director of Tigray Development Association, Aklilu Hailemichael.
